AIG Group Management Division, a unit of the life insurance subsidiaries of AIG, has launched its new group life insurance product package that will be offered to businesses located in 15 countries of the EU.

Administered and underwritten by AIG Life (Ireland), and managed by the AIG Global Benefits Network, the new employee benefit product suite aligns to the freedom to provide services provisions of the European Commission’s third life directive.

The company said that the new product provides benefits, which include: package of Pan-European group life and accidental death riders for corporations employing personnel in the European Union (EU) countries; ability to harmonize renewal dates and benefits structures of existing contracts and customer service teams in EU time zones, fluent in five core languages: English, French, German, Italian and Spanish.
